Presidential Scholarship

Merit-based award covers 100% of tuition, books, and fees

Requirements:

  • Offered by scholarship committee based on GPA and essay. General guidelines for the committee include 3.25 cumulative high school GPA.
  • Renewable up to 4 semesters with a 3.25 college GPA and full-time enrollment.
  • Limit of 5 new recipients per year.
  • All Associate, Bachelor and Nursing students eligible to apply.

Fifteen 2 Finish

The F2F Scholarship aims to support students in completing their degrees on time or ahead of schedule by granting a 50% discount for each credit beyond 12 hours.

Henry W. Bloch Program

This award covers 100% of tuition and fees for up to six semesters at Donnelly College and then upon transfer to UMKC or Rockhurst University, 100% of tuition for up to six semesters.

Requirements:

  • Must live in Kansas City metropolitan area
  • Must demonstrate financial need
  • Have not earned more than 30 credits
  • High school diploma or GED
  • Not eligible for other merit-based scholarships

Catholic High School Award

$500 per semester

Requirements:

  • Provide an official transcript from accredited Catholic HS
  • Maintain full-time enrollment status
  • Renewable up to eight semesters (excludes summer)

Bizfest Scholarship

Merit-based award of $2,000 per semester

Requirements:

  • 3.5 cumulative high school GPA
  • Participation in BizFest (certificate required)
  • Minimum ACT score of 18 or Donnelly test equivalent
  • Award is renewable with a 3.25 college GPA
  • Limit of four new recipients per year

Hispanic Development Fund

Awarded annually based on availability

Requirements:

  • Be of Hispanic Heritage
  • Graduating/have graduated from a Greater Kansas City metropolitan area high school or obtain a general equivalency diploma (GED) from a local organization
  • Attend/have attended a Greater Kansas City metropolitan area high school for the last three years prior to graduation
  • Accepted or enrolled in a fully accredited college or university and working toward an associate, bachelor, or graduate degree. (Applicants attending vocational or trade schools are ineligible)
  • Enroll or be enrolled as a full-time student. (A minimum 12 credit hours for undergraduate and 9 credit hours for graduate

KC Scholars

KC Scholars is available to low- and modest-income high school students who are in public, charter, and private schools and home- schooled; and adults with some college, but no degree, and adults with associate degree who are supported to earn a bachelor's degree. Donnelly College will accept these two scholarships from the KC Scholars Program:

Traditional Scholarship

Applications submitted by students in 11th grade
Awarded up to $10,000 per year, renewable up to five years
Must maintain a 2.5 GPA or higher

Adult Learner

Must be age 24 or older
Awarded up to $5,000 per year, renewable up to five years

Kansas Board of Regents

The Kansas Board of Regents is a devoted advocate for the quality and effectiveness of Kansas's public postsecondary educational system and is committed to expanding participation for all qualified Kansans. There are over 15 scholarships currently available for application.

Each scholarship has its own eligibility criteria and application requirements. Generally, each scholarship program requires the recipient to:

  • Be a Kansas resident
  • Enroll in a qualified program
  • Enroll at a Kansas college or university
  • Not already awarded an undergraduate degree, unless you are applying for the Nursing or Teaching Service Scholarships
